The early episodes establish Amarpal Singh not as a born criminal, but as a bright, ambitious UPSC aspirant.
Unlike previous seasons that focused heavily on raw gangsterism, Darr Ki Rajneeti shifts its lens toward the intersection of crime, caste dynamics, and electoral politics. The narrative explores how fear ("Darr") is systematically weaponized to gain democratic power ("Rajneeti"). Over the course of the first six episodes, audiences witness Saheb building his empire, establishing a Robin Hood-esque persona among his community, and inevitably making powerful enemies within the ruling government.
